The Bipolar Ionization Air Purifier Module is a high-performance ion generator designed for HVAC installation, producing over 12 million positive and 13 million negative ions per cubic centimeter. With a compact design and robust manufacturing quality, it enhances air quality by neutralizing pollutants, making it ideal for homes, laboratories, and clean rooms.

18 months and still working
Installed this into my 3M filtrate personal air purifier. It has been working for 18+ months. Monthly, I take a Q-tip and wipe one end of the ion, with the other end of the Q-tip to wipe the other end of the iron output. I have an ion meter, and I test it every 6-9 months, so that I know it is working. It takes away smells and makes the filter more efficient, by making the particles larger and they get stuck inside the filter. Itโs amazing with a Vietnamese wife with super pungent foods!!! A little indoor air quality better than none.
I purchased the shopcorp 110-120vac negative/positive ion generator because of price and for what it is supposed to do. So I hard wired this Unit inside my hvac unit and fixed the wire leads close to the indoor blower. I did this so the ions generated are pulled in and spread through out my home. The unit seems to be working. Once I had it hooked up I could feel the energy flowing between the two ion generator leads. I mounted these leads about 3inches apart. Unit has been installed for a month or more now and feel like it maybe doing a little something for indoor air quality.
